Managers are definitely one of the most-discussed topics I've seen in the forums. I'll look for corrections/alternate opinions, but the rough framework I've built up in my head on this topic from reading others' posts includes:

* Managers have a non-trivial influence on your game, but they won't necessarily make or break you.

* There's a ton of dreck in the new managers pool, most of them managers that no one will ever touch. That dreck needs to be cleaned out from time to time to make searching easier.

* Finding a manager who is positive in nearly every area is truly a rarity, though it happens. Instead, it's more realistic to see semi-positive options such as this and this. Choosing which positives and weaknesses to take is matter of choice.

* Finding even those semi-positives can be a chore. I use custom HTML for this domain that highlights links I haven't clicked in a darker blue. It's better than nothing but not perfect; someone could throw back a player I looked at that I wanted, for example, and I may miss that player.

* To Steve's credit, he's performed the occasional pool cleaning and added an update to randomly add new managers throughout the season rather than all at once at a designated time. Some prefer the old way, I prefer the new. Still, others clamor for better, and there probably is slightly more room for better.

I don't say this to dredge up another long discussion on the topic. Rather, that's how I view the situation currently. Managers are important, but they're only a small piece. We should hope for better ways for the uncontracted managers (those who haven't been picked up over X days) to drop out of the queue. Should we hope for a quantity increase of "better" managers? That's a different argument that gets into the potential devaluing of managers by shrinking the variability in the pool. *shrug*

I would like to see an add on option for managers. Keep the system the way it is but also create a new way of adding a manager where occasionally a manager becomes available for higher where teams could submit a salary they are willing to pay that manager if they hire him. The highest offer gets him. Ties are awarded to the lowest ranked team. I would probably suggest a blind bid system on the salary.

@brentswagger, this has been suggested for players before and I still don't like it for managers. I've seen what bidding systems do for games, and it isn't good imo. Rich teams would always outbid poor teams for the best managers, which would favor teams in the upper leagues. You become a rich team in this game by winning ball games at levels V-III. I came to this game after playing GoalUnited for a year, bidding was one of the two things that drove me away from that game (along with it being pay to win).

In the end, I feel the new manager hiring system is an area that can be improved upon. It's not announced when managers are added and it's first come first serve. I think it puts owners with smaller amounts of time available to focus on broken bat at a disadvantage. The search task is also not very user friendly for managers. I would even favor a system where there was a notification of new managers added and an initial waiver type system similar to free agent waivers so that everyone that wanted a manager would have an equal chance at adding them. It just doesn't feel fair for the more casual but active owner that wants to improve their manager they way it is presently set up.
